Ubuntu 18.04.1 LTS下搭建git伺服器
阿新 • • 發佈:2018-12-31
sudo apt-get install git
安裝好git
sudo adduser git
系統會提示設定密碼,此時請設定好你的密碼,還會要你設定email之類的此時可以按Enter回車預設為空
sudo vim /home/git/.ssh/authorized_keys
此時把你電腦裡面的rsa_pub(公鑰)複製到authorized_keys中儲存退出
sudo mkdir -p /home/gitcode
建立一個目錄作為git倉庫
sudo chown git:git /home/gitcode/
把倉庫所有者指定為git
cd /home/gitcode
git init --bare gittest.git
使用git建立一個名為gittest的空倉庫
sudo chown -R git:git gittest.git
把控倉庫的所有者指為git使用者git組
最後到git資料夾所在目錄 cd /home下
sudo chown -R git:git git
把git資料夾下所有東西的所有者都指向git
好了git伺服器已經可以用了 注意執行這些命令務必加sudo否則可能不成功
在本地電腦執行git clone [email protected]:/home/gitcode/gittest.git 輸入你之前設定的git密碼即可克隆了
親測git clone 和 IDEA全家桶都可以